About Book
Textbook of Pharmacognosy and Phytochemistry-I is an essential guide for students and professionals in the pharmaceutical and life sciences fields. This comprehensive textbook explores the vast domain of natural products used in medicine, highlighting their origin, evaluation, and applications. It begins with an introduction to pharmacognosy, tracing its historical development and modern-day scope.
The book delves into the sources of drugs, including plant, animal, marine, and tissue culture origins. It provides detailed classifications of drugs, their adulteration, and methods for crude drug evaluation. Readers will gain insights into the cultivation, processing, and conservation of medicinal plants, emphasizing the importance of sustainability.
Advanced topics like plant tissue culture and secondary metabolites are thoroughly discussed, along with their roles in pharmaceutical development. Special emphasis is placed on the pharmacognosy of various traditional medicine systems like Ayurveda, Unani, Siddha, and Chinese medicine.
It also explores primary metabolites like carbohydrates, proteins, and lipids, detailing their therapeutic and commercial applications. An intriguing section on marine drugs showcases the potential of novel agents derived from marine sources. With its structured content, clear explanations, and practical relevance, this book serves as an invaluable resource for understanding the role of natural products in modern pharmacology.
